Tai Chi a Potted Guide: Tai Chi is a graceful and ancient martial art that fuses relaxed and subtle moves with breathing and relaxation techniques. Created in China during the 13th Century the art is now taught and practiced across the world because of its health advantages. It has been demonstrated to increase balance and flexibility, decrease tension and develop lower limb muscle strength, especially in those people aged 60 and over.

When you've studied and mastered most of the basic moves of Tai Chi you can practise it pretty much anywhere you feel comfortable since you do not need any specific equipment to practice. For the Tai Chi workouts all you'll need are loose-fitting, comfy clothes which will not constrain your movements, whenever possible you should wear plain or subdued colours because the center of attention must be on the routines, not your garments. In fact you do not even need to have shoes for Tai Chi as some classes might require you to practice bare footed.

It is generally a wise move to get help and advice from your family doctor before beginning any Tai Chi classes notably if you have an existing health condition or other health worries. You might like to observe certain precautions if you have a hernia, get spells of dizziness, suffer from back pain, have chronic osteoporosis, are pregnant or have recently recovered from an infection. Tai Chi is in general a gentle exercise and is unlikely to cause any sort of injury if conducted in the correct way. The workouts entail a lot of flowing, easy movements that don't inflict stresses on the joints or muscles.
